The total revenue function for the demand of a new computer game can be obtained by multiplying the price consumers will pay by the number of games sold. This can be expressed as R(x) = x * (59.5 - 8ln(x)).
Step-by-step explanation:
The total revenue can be calculated by multiplying the price consumers will pay (p(x)) by the number of games sold (x).
So, using the given demand function p(x) = 59.5 - 8ln(x), the total revenue function is R(x) = x * p(x).
To calculate R(x), you need to substitute the given demand function p(x) into the expression for R(x).
R(x) = x * (59.5 - 8ln(x)).
